In August 2020 Illinois enacted a law that makes it a Class 3 felony to attack a retail worker whos relaying the stores health and safety policies or the rules guidelines or recommendations issued by a public health agency during an emergency or disastersuch as requirements for wearing a face mask or practicing social distancing during the COVID-19 pandemic.
